LEGISLATION TO BE CONSIDERED
SB25
FRED MILLS
ETHICS
- Provides relative to prohibited conduct by state employees and agencies. (8/1/18)
SB34
WALSWORTH
PUBLIC MEETINGS
- Authorizes a city or parish school board or a parish governing authority to discuss economic development projects in executive session. (8/1/18)
SB41
FRED MILLS
ETHICS
- Provides relative to former agency head employment. (8/1/18)
SB44
APPEL
ETHICS
- Provides that certain provisions of the Code of Governmental Ethics are applicable to judges. (gov sig) (OR SEE FISC NOTE GF EX)
SB67
CLAITOR
PUBLIC RECORDS
- Provides relative to certain reports of coroners. (8/1/18)
SB121
PERRY
ETHICS
- Provides an exception for a hospital service district commissioner that owns a pharmacy. (8/1/18)
SB133
HEWITT
PUBLIC RECORDS
- Provides relative to documents submitted to the Louisiana State Fire Marshal. (8/1/18) (EN INCREASE SD EX See Note)
SB168
THOMPSON
PUBLIC RECORDS
- Exempts certain Department of Agriculture and Forestry records from the Public Records Law. (gov sig)
SB218
TROY CARTER
CONSTITUTION CONVENTION
- Provides for calling a limited constitutional convention for finance matters. (gov sig) (EG INCREASE GF EX See Note)
SB242
MORRELL
LEGISLATIVE SESSIONS
- Constitutional amendment to provide for consideration of certain matters during regular sessions in even-numbered years. (2/3 - CA3s2(A))
SB312
ERIC LAFLEUR
PUBLIC MEETINGS
- Revises procedure regarding meetings to propose or renew taxes and to call an election. (8/1/18)
SB329
CORTEZ
CONSTITUTION CONVENTION
- Provides for calling a constitutional convention. (gov sig)
SB376
SMITH
PUBLIC EMPLOYEES
- Provides relative to the definition of a "governmental function". (8/1/18)
